* [PATCH v6 0/2] Extend SSR notifications framework @ 2020-06-24 2:23 Rishabh Bhatnagar 2020-06-24 2:23 ` [PATCH v6 1/2] remoteproc: qcom: Add per subsystem SSR notification Rishabh Bhatnagar 2020-06-24 2:23 ` [PATCH v6 2/2] remoteproc: qcom: Add notification types to SSR Rishabh Bhatnagar 0 siblings, 2 replies; 7+ messages in thread From: Rishabh Bhatnagar @ 2020-06-24 2:23 UTC (permalink / raw) To: linux-remoteproc, linux-kernel Cc: bjorn.andersson, tsoni, psodagud, sidgup, elder, Rishabh Bhatnagar This set of patches gives kernel client drivers the ability to register for a particular remoteproc's SSR notifications. Also the notifications are extended to before/after-powerup/shutdown stages. It also fixes the bug where clients need to register for notifications again if the platform driver is removed. This is done by creating a global list of per-remoteproc notification info data structures which remain static. An API is exported to register for a remoteproc's SSR notifications and uses remoteproc's ssr_name and notifier block as arguments. * [PATCH v6 1/2] remoteproc: qcom: Add per subsystem SSR notification 2020-06-24 2:23 [PATCH v6 0/2] Extend SSR notifications framework Rishabh Bhatnagar @ 2020-06-24 2:23 ` Rishabh Bhatnagar 2020-07-08 23:56 ` Alex Elder 2020-07-13 16:26 ` Jon Hunter 2020-06-24 2:23 ` [PATCH v6 2/2] remoteproc: qcom: Add notification types to SSR Rishabh Bhatnagar 1 sibling, 2 replies; 7+ messages in thread From: Rishabh Bhatnagar @ 2020-06-24 2:23 UTC (permalink / raw) To: linux-remoteproc, linux-kernel Cc: bjorn.andersson, tsoni, psodagud, sidgup, elder, Rishabh Bhatnagar Currently there is a single notification chain which is called whenever any remoteproc shuts down. This leads to all the listeners being notified, and is not an optimal design as kernel drivers might only be interested in listening to notifications from a particular remoteproc. Create a global list of remoteproc notification info data structures. This will hold the name and notifier_list information for a particular remoteproc. The API to register for notifications will use name argument to retrieve the notification info data structure and the notifier block will be added to that data structure's notification chain. Also move from blocking notifier to srcu notifer based implementation to support dynamic notifier head creation. * [PATCH v6 2/2] remoteproc: qcom: Add notification types to SSR 2020-06-24 2:23 [PATCH v6 0/2] Extend SSR notifications framework Rishabh Bhatnagar 2020-06-24 2:23 ` [PATCH v6 1/2] remoteproc: qcom: Add per subsystem SSR notification Rishabh Bhatnagar @ 2020-06-24 2:23 ` Rishabh Bhatnagar 2020-07-08 23:56 ` Alex Elder 1 sibling, 1 reply; 7+ messages in thread From: Rishabh Bhatnagar @ 2020-06-24 2:23 UTC (permalink / raw) To: linux-remoteproc, linux-kernel Cc: bjorn.andersson, tsoni, psodagud, sidgup, elder, Rishabh Bhatnagar The SSR subdevice only adds callback for the unprepare event. Add callbacks for prepare, start and prepare events. The client driver for a particular remoteproc might be interested in knowing the status of the remoteproc while undergoing SSR, not just when the remoteproc has finished shutting down.
